摘要
In this letter, a simple approach to design a reconfigurable feeding network (RFN) for antenna array beam scanning is presented. By combining a 3 dB power divider and a reconfigurable delay line group (RDLG), the two output signals with 2m+n sets of uniformly distributed phase gradients (PGs) can be obtained. And by adopting multi two-output RFNs and multi-stage design, a RFN for generating 2m+n continuously distributed beams is constructed. For verifying the design method, a microstrip four-output RFN for generating four scanning beams is implemented, fabricated and measured. The measured results are consistent with the theoretical analysis, which provides the validity of the design. And the design of the RFN can be used as a candidate of the feeding network for antenna array beam scanning.
